Output 64508f3c26480e2c6b80aae7effd02e150a6a4778cb0196ceaf0b9dcca28f75b:3

value
5967645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 699bfa382722ef1609d975862f9c303e3ca1b572 OP_EQUAL
address
3BKRjBoSmQoQhpQTP7x7ynhwFaALdQ34vt
transaction
64508f3c26480e2c6b80aae7effd02e150a6a4778cb0196ceaf0b9dcca28f75b
spent
true